[python之路]學習路線

python基礎css

#爲何要學python?
python在知名公司普遍應用,谷歌、cia、nasa、youtobe、dropbox、instagram、facebook、redhat、豆瓣、知乎、搜狐、金山、騰訊、盛大、網易、百度、阿里、淘寶、土豆、新浪、果殼等使用python完成各類任務。html

#python擅長的領域:
web開發:django、pyramid、tornado、bottle、flask、web.py
網絡編程:twisted、requests、scrapy、paramiko
科學運算:scipy、pandas、ipython
gui圖形開發:wxpython、pyqt、kivy
運維自動化:openstack、saltstack、ansible、騰訊藍鯨python

#python的前途:
美國開發平均100k美金
北京開發10k起
語言排行第五ios

#python用途
全棧開發,開發自動化工具等web

#語言基礎算法

簡單介紹
變量和字符編碼
數據類型
流程控制
經常使用模塊
函數
迭代器
裝飾器
遞歸
迭代
反射
面向對象編程
購物車程序
atm信用卡程序開發
計算器程序開發
模擬人生遊戲開發sql

#網絡編程
socket c/s編程、twisted異步網絡框架、網絡爬蟲開發
多線程、多進程、協程gevent、select\poll\epoll
生產者消費者模型
審計堡壘機開發
FTP服務器開發
批量命令,文件分佈工具
RabbitMQ消息隊列、sqlAlchemy ORM
類saltsatack配置管理工具開發
reids、memcache、mongodb緩存數據庫mongodb

#web基礎開發
HTML、css基礎
dom編程
原聲js學習
jQuery、EasyUI、AngulaJS
Ajax異步加載
Highchart畫圖
Bootstrapdocker

#算法&設計模式
冒泡、二叉樹、哈希、拆半等常見算法學習
工廠模式、單例模式、享元模式、代理模式等經常使用設計模式數據庫

#PY web框架
mvc框架講解
自行開發一個web框架
django、tornado、flask、bottle、webpy框架學習
session、中間件、orm、cookies、csrf、form
restful api框架
權限管理後臺開發
開發bbs論壇
開發web聊天室

#項目實戰購物商城開發主機管理+任務編排+運維審計堡壘機開發分佈式nagios、zabbix監控產品開發cmdb資產管理開發基於用戶視角的網站訪問質量監測分析平臺開發docker自動化管理平臺開發openstack二次開發

相關文章
相關標籤/搜索